Savannah Guthrie’s Mother Reported Missing

  • Nancy Guthrie, Savannah Guthrie's 84-year-old mother, went missing and her Tucson home is an active crime scene.
  • The sheriff said she has mobility and medication needs and investigators fear foul play as family and federal agencies assist.

Diplomacy Amid Military Posturing

  • U.S. and Iran are planning direct talks in Istanbul with regional partners present, signaling both diplomatic and military pressure.
  • The U.S. seeks a broader deal covering nuclear, missiles, and proxy funding while Iran appears open mainly to nuclear discussions.

Trade Push Tied To Geopolitics

  • President Trump announced a trade move with India reducing U.S. tariffs and seeking higher Indian purchases of U.S. goods.
  • The administration frames cutting India's Russian oil purchases as leverage to punish Russia economically.
